Specific Water Well Detail |
|
|
| Location Info | |||
| Owner: Frager Farms | Status: Constructed | ||
| Location: T1S, R2E, Sec. 24, NW NW NE NE | County: Washington | ||
| Directions: from Hwy 15 and 27th Rd, 0.75 mi E and 180 feet S | |||
| Latitude: 39.958606 | Longitude: -97.1482957 | Datum NAD 27 | |
| Latitude: 39.958611 | Longitude: -97.148611 | Datum NAD 83 | |
| Longitude and latitude from GPS measurements. | |||
| GPS Latitude: 39.958611 | GPS Longitude: -97.148611 | Datum NAD83 | |
| View well on interactive map | |||
| General Info | ||
| Well Depth: 100 ft. | Elevation: 1479 ft. | |
| Static Water Level: 27 ft. | Est. Yield: 250 gpm. | |
| Comp. Date: 22-Sep-2015 | Well Use: Irrigation | |
| DWR Applic. #: 45144 | Other ID: | |

Chemical Sample Submitted?: No
Water Well disinfected?: Yes | ||
| Ground water encountered: 91 ft. | ||
| Bore hole diameter: 27 inches to 100 ft | ||
| Casing Info | ||
| Casing Type: PVC
Casing Joints: Glued |
Diam: 12 in. to 40 ft | |
| Casing height above land surface: 12 in
Casing Weight: lbs/ft Wall thickness or gauge no.: 0.490 | ||
| Screen and Perforation Info | ||
| Screen Type: PVC | Screen Openings: Mill slot | |
| Screen-perforated intervals | From: 40 ft to 100 ft | |
| Gravel pack intervals | From: 20 ft to 100 ft | |
| Grout Info | ||
| Grout used: HOLEPLUG | From: 0 to 20 ft | |

| Lithologic Log
(Log data entered from KOLAR.) | ||
| From: 0 ft. to 18 ft. | top soil and sand | |
| From: 18 ft. to 68 ft. | fine-medium sand, sandstone, trace s. sand | |
| From: 68 ft. to 88 ft. | fine sand and sandstone | |
| From: 88 ft. to 95 ft. | fine sand, sandstone and iron pyrite | |
| From: 95 ft. to 100 ft. | shale | |
